DOD IG says Army could waste nearly $22 billion on augmented reality headsets – FCW

“The purpose of user acceptance testing is to consistently monitor the likelihood of meeting user needs. The more prototype testing with Soldiers and incorporating changes based on Soldier feedback, the higher likelihood of their acceptance of IVAS,” the document states.

The IG requested the Army acquisition chief reconsider the position.
